About Perfume: The Story of a Murderer
Perfume: The Story of a Murderer is a 2006 Crime, Fantasy and Drama film running 2 h 27 min. Originally in English, produced in Germany, France and Spain. It holds a TMDB score of 7.4 from 5,119 viewers.
In the heart of 18th-century France, "Perfume: The Story of a Murderer" follows the life of Jean-Baptiste Grenouille, a gifted but socially isolated orphan played by Ben Whishaw. Born with an extraordinary sense of smell, Grenouille navigates the stench of the world around him, from the foul air of the Parisian streets to the intricate scents of the human body. His obsession with capturing the perfect fragrance becomes the catalyst for a series of dark and chilling events, leading him to commit unspeakable acts in his quest for olfactory mastery. The film delves into themes of obsession, identity, and the nature of desire, exploring how Grenouille's extraordinary abilities serve as both a gift and a curse. Director Tom Tykwer crafts a taut narrative that oscillates between moments of bleak humor and harrowing tension, creating a mood that is both unsettling and compelling. The story intertwines elements of crime and fantasy, presenting Grenouille's journey as a tragic exploration of what it means to be truly human amidst a backdrop of moral decay and societal indifference. Released in 2006 and based on the novel by Patrick Süskind, "Perfume" hails from Germany and has garnered a mixed but notable reception for its bold storytelling and unique visual style. The film speaks to an audience intrigued by the darker facets of human nature and the extremes of ambition. With its rich atmospheric setting and complex characters, it offers a haunting reflection on the price of obsession and the lengths to which one might go in pursuit of their desires.
